Q: Is 2,073,434 a Prime Number?
A: No, 2,073,434 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 2073434 can be evenly divided by 1 2 11 22 79 158 869 1,193 1,738 2,386 13,123 26,246 94,247 188,494 1,036,717 and 2,073,434, with no remainder.
Since 2,073,434 cannot be divided by just 1 and 2,073,434, it is not a prime number.
